The SCE Platform

The SCE family of programmable network devices is capable of performing application-layer stateful-flow inspection of IP traffic, and controlling that traffic based on configurable rules. The SCE platform is a purpose-built network device that uses ASIC components and RISC processors to go beyond packet counting and delve deeper into the contents of network traffic. Providing programmable, stateful inspection of bidirectional traffic flows and mapping these flows with user ownership, the SCE platforms provide a real-time classification of network usage. This information provides the basis of the SCE platform advanced traffic-control and bandwidth- shaping functionality. Where most bandwidth shaper functionality ends, the SCE platform provides more control and shaping options including:

Layer 7 stateful wire-speed packet inspection and classification

Robust support for over 600 protocols and applications including:

General—HTTP, HTTPS, FTP, TELNET, NNTP, SMTP, POP3, IMAP, WAP, and others

P2P file sharing—FastTrack-KazaA, Gnutella, BitTorrent, Winny, Hotline, eDonkey, DirectConnect, Piolet, and others

P2P VoIP—Skype, Skinny, DingoTel, and others

Streaming & Multimedia—RTSP, SIP, HTTP streaming, RTP/RTCP, and others

Programmable system core for flexible reporting and bandwidth control

Transparent network and BSS/OSS integration into existing networks

Subscriber awareness that relates traffic and usage to specific customers

Cisco Systems OL-7821-04, SCE 1000 2xGBE is an advanced network service appliance designed to deliver superior performance and reliability for service providers seeking to optimize their networks. This compact yet powerful device is integral in addressing the growing demands of data traffic in telecommunications and data centers.

One of the standout features of the SCE 1000 is its ability to support both IPv4 and IPv6 networks, ensuring compatibility with current and future networking protocols. This dual-stack capability empowers service providers to seamlessly transition and integrate next-generation applications without jeopardizing service quality.

The SCE 1000 is equipped with two Gigabit Ethernet (GbE) ports that enhance its connectivity options and allow for increased bandwidth. This dual-port configuration supports high-speed data transfers and streamlined operations, making it ideal for enterprises with substantial networking demands. Its flexible interface options facilitate easy integration into existing network architectures without requiring extensive reconfiguration.

An essential characteristic of the SCE 1000 is its advanced service creation technology, which allows for dynamic traffic management. This feature intelligently prioritizes and optimizes applications, ensuring that critical services receive the bandwidth they need while maintaining overall network efficiency. Service providers can leverage this capability to implement Quality of Service (QoS) policies, delivering a consistent user experience even during peak usage times.

Furthermore, the SCE 1000 supports various traffic engineering methods, including deep packet inspection and application recognition, enabling operators to monitor and control network traffic effectively. This capability is particularly crucial in identifying and mitigating potential network threats, resulting in enhanced security measures.

With its robust architecture, the device also offers scalability, accommodating the growing network requirements of service providers. As businesses grow and data use expands, the SCE 1000 can adapt without compromising performance.
